Hosting mold sector with 11th edition between the dates of 1-3 March 2017, Asiamold will give place to 3D technology just like previous years.

Asiamold 2016 held between the dates of 20-22 September, brought not only mold and die but also 3D sector together. 3D Printing Asia Zone received great interest from additive manufacturing’s leaders and users. In Asiamold 2017 whose organisation date is set,  3D will be on the forefront one more time.

Acknowledging this market growth, the organiser of Asiamold is bringing back the 3D Printing 3d-printing-asia-zone_printing3dnews1Asia Zone as a key highlight of the 2016 edition. The zone will gather world-leading suppliers in 3D printing, rapid prototyping, CAD/CAM software development, 3D laser engraving and other related areas in one location. This helps manufacturing- and consumer-focused buyers to streamline sourcing.

This year, more than 60 world- renowned 3D manufacturing brands participated, a 25% increase from the previous edition. They will present the sector’s most innovative products that may change the mould and die casting industry as we know it.

Hosting 320 attendees from 3D market in 2016 edition, Asiamold is planning to bring more than 700 attendees in 65,000 square meters space. Aside from 3D technology, innovation sin molding, casting and automation segments will also be presented to over 65,000 visitors in the fair which is organized by Guangzhou Guangya Messe Frankfurt Co Ltd.
